About Ollyver
Ollyver, a masculine name with American roots, is a variation of the classic and beloved name Oliver. Oliver, itself, is of English origin and means "olive tree." The name Ollyver often evokes strength and resilience due to its connection to the olive tree's strong imagery of life and peacefulness in the face of adversity.
